比特币钱包工作原理详解
比特币作为第一种去中心化的数字货币,自2009年问世以来,便引领了全球加密货币的潮流。然而,很多新手用户在接触比特币时,往往对比特币钱包的工作原理感到困惑。本文将深入探讨比特币钱包的工作机制,帮助读者更好地理解这一重要概念。
比特币钱包与传统钱包存在显著不同。传统钱包存储的是纸币,而比特币钱包则是一个数字工具,用于存储和管理您的比特币。它的工作原理基于区块链技术,这使得比特币在转账和接收方面具有高度的安全性和匿名性。
### 2. 比特币钱包的基本概念 #### 什么是比特币钱包比特币钱包是一个用于接收、存储和发送比特币的应用或程序。它的作用就像是一个物理钱包,用来保管现金和信用卡。如果没有钱包,用户无法有效地管理他们的比特币资产。
#### 各种类型的比特币钱包比特币钱包大致可以分为以下几种类型:
1. **热钱包**:也称为在线钱包,始终与互联网连接,方便用户进行快速交易,但也相对容易受到黑客攻击。 2. **冷钱包**:与互联网断开连接的存储方式,更加安全,适合长期持有比特币的用户。 3. **硬件钱包**:专门的物理设备,通常具有加密和安全功能,提供比软件钱包更强的安全性。 4. **纸钱包**:用户将比特币地址和私钥打印在纸上,从而避免被黑客攻击,但易丢失或损坏。 ### 3. 比特币钱包的工作原理 #### 钱包地址和私钥的关系每个比特币钱包都有一对关联的密钥:公钥和私钥。公钥相当于用户的比特币地址,允许其他人向该地址转账。而私钥则是用于签名交易的唯一数字代码,持有私钥的人可以控制相应的比特币资产。
重要的是,私钥必须保持秘密,因为任何人获取私钥都可以控制相应的钱包资金。使用复杂的密码和多重认证可以增加安全性。
#### 签名与验证过程当用户向其他比特币地址发送资金时,钱包会使用私钥对交易进行签名。这个签名证明了交易者拥有相应的比特币,并且没有被篡改。交易信息会发送到比特币网络,由分布在全球的节点进行验证,确认交易的合法性。
交易成功后,将其打包到区块链中,任何人都可以查看该交易的历史记录,这也是比特币的透明性所在。
### 4. 比特币交易的流程 #### 用户发起交易用户在钱包中输入接收者的比特币地址和交易金额,并选择相应的手续费后,点击发送。钱包内的加密算法会生成交易签名,确保安全性。
#### 矿工与区块链的角色交易信息被广播到比特币网络,矿工会尝试将其打包到一个区块中。矿工通过解决复杂的数学问题来确认这一交易,并获得一定的比特币奖励。被确认的交易会在区块链中永久保存,形成透明的交易记录。
### 5. 比特币钱包的安全性 #### 如何保护私钥保护私钥是确保比特币安全的关键。使用强密码,定期更新账户安全设置,启用两步验证,定期备份钱包等都是非常有效的安全措施。
#### 常见的安全威胁及防范一些常见的安全威胁包括钓鱼攻击、恶意软件和黑客入侵。用户应保持警惕,不要点击未知链接,避免在不安全的环境下访问电子钱包。在多用户环境中,确保使用VPN和防火墙来确保数据安全。
### 6. 结论比特币钱包是参与比特币生态系统的必要工具。了解其工作原理,不仅有助于提升安全性,还能使用户在使用比特币时更加从容。随着技术的发展,我们期待更安全、更便捷的比特币钱包的出现。
## 相关问题 ### 问题 1: 比特币钱包与传统银行账户有什么区别?比特币钱包与传统银行账户的区别
比特币钱包和传统银行账户在概念上有所不同:
1. **去中心化**:比特币的交易是去中心化的,不受任何机构控制,而银行账户则由银行管理。 2. **匿名性**:比特币钱包在交易上相对匿名,而银行账户的交易记录都受到监管。 3. **交易时间**:比特币交易可以在几分钟内完成,而传统银行往往需要数小时到几天来处理交易。 4. **费用**:比特币交易的手续费相对较低,特别是在高额交易时,而银行手续费通常较高。 ### 问题 2: 如何选择合适的比特币钱包?选择合适比特币钱包的指南
选择比特币钱包时,用户应该考虑以下因素:
1. **安全性**:选择具备良好安全措施的钱包,支持多重认证和冷存储功能。 2. **用户友好性**:界面是否易于使用,是否支持多平台使用。 3. **兼容性**:钱包是否支持多种数字货币,以及与其他服务的兼容性。 4. **社区支持**:选择拥有活跃开发者和用户社区的钱包,可以获得更好的支持。 ### 问题 3: 比特币钱包丢失了怎么办?比特币钱包丢失后的应对措施
如果比特币钱包丢失,用户可以采取以下措施进行处理:
1. **恢复助记词**:大多数钱包在创建时提供助记词,用户可以通过这组词恢复钱包。 2. **联系服务商**:如果是在线钱包,可以尝试联系提供商寻求帮助。 3. **备份文件**:经常备份钱包文件,对于可能的丢失风险有预警作用。 ### 问题 4: 比特币交易的速度和确认机制是怎样的?比特币交易速度与确认机制
比特币的交易速度受到区块生成时间的影响,通常大约为10分钟。而确认机制则是建立在区块链的共识算法之上。矿工通过解决复杂的哈希问题进行区块创建,通过比特币网络的验证使交易得到确认。
### 问题 5: 比特币钱包的备份与恢复有哪些最佳实践?比特币钱包的备份与恢复最佳实践
备份比特币钱包时,建议使用以下方法:
1. **定期备份**:定期将钱包内容备份到安全的外部存储设备中。 2. **保管助记词**:将助记词安全保管,以防止意外丢失。 3. **使用多重备份**:建议多种方式备份,例如云存储和物理磁盘结合。 ### 问题 6: 使用比特币钱包时的法律风险是什么?使用比特币钱包的法律风险
使用比特币钱包的法律风险主要包括:
1. **合规性**:不同国家对于比特币的法律地位不同,用户需了解所在国家的法律框架。 2. **交易税收**:比特币交易在某些国家可能需要纳税,用户需确保按时申报。 3. **诈骗**:由于比特币交易的匿名性,用户可能成为诈骗的受害者,因此需保持警惕,选择正规渠道交易。 通过对这些问题的详细讨论,用户能够得到实用和深入的知识,进一步理解比特币钱包的工作原理,以及如何安全有效地管理他们的加密资产。